Output 6153166f0d30ea64558db4db4b1c4273bf2621d0e86060f1cca0068e37d90376:18

value
267323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84121476a082fb741493b6805874fa7eafeaf9d9 OP_EQUAL
address
3DjLn5fgz471pAyVcwNhDJJqkFbQ52gKnN
transaction
6153166f0d30ea64558db4db4b1c4273bf2621d0e86060f1cca0068e37d90376
spent
true